Exploring Coordination Between the Ministry of Social Affairs and the Southern Transitional Council in the Field of Humanitarian Work

His Excellency Dr. Mohammed Saeed Al-Zaouri, Minister of Social Affairs and Labor, met this morning in his office in the capital, Aden, with Attorney Niran Souqi, Head of the Relief and Humanitarian Work Authority of the Southern Transitional Council.


During the meeting, they discussed several issues related to humanitarian work and the activities of international and local organizations in the field of relief and service delivery.


Minister Al-Zaouri highlighted the Ministry’s role in supervising civil society organizations and their humanitarian and developmental activities in the southern governorates and liberated areas, in accordance with the prevailing laws and regulations, and in coordination with relevant entities.


He pointed out the challenges facing relief and humanitarian efforts, noting that through its Projects Committee at the central office, the Ministry has succeeded in directing institutional and organizational support to the most economically and socially needy areas. He emphasized the importance of close coordination with all active entities to address the obstacles facing such efforts. He also stressed the need to obtain beneficiary family data from official sources, under the supervision of the Central Bureau of Statistics, by conducting surveys and preparing forms containing accurate information about families in neighborhoods and districts in a scientific and professional manner to ensure fair distribution of aid.


Al-Zaouri praised the efforts of the Southern Transitional Council leadership, represented by President Aidarous Al-Zubaidi, in supporting the activities of UN, international, and civil society organizations, facilitating the implementation of their humanitarian programs and projects, and removing obstacles that may hinder their operations. He emphasized the need to enhance coordination among all parties to ensure the continued flow of humanitarian aid to various regions.


For her part, Attorney Niran Souqi expressed her appreciation for the efforts made by the Ministry of Social Affairs and Labor, under the leadership of His Excellency Dr. Al-Zaouri, in addressing the challenges facing humanitarian work and finding effective solutions. She stressed the importance of strengthening joint coordination between the Ministry and the Transitional Council in this field.


The meeting was attended by several Deputy Ministers and General Directors of the Ministry’s central office
